Shelby Valley's scoring, according to the box score in the Herald-Leader :

E. Justice 16
Newsome 11
Hatfield 8
J. Bryant 8
L. Bryant 8
J. Justice 4

Also Valley was apparently down 24-15 at the break, then clawed their way back in the second half. The game summary reports that Taylor Newsome's basket that put Valley ahead 55-54 was their only lead of the entire game.
